I've asked this question in the past but forgot what I did with the answer.

 

My wife and I share duties, she's creative and edits the photos, I have a color deficiency and do the organizing and tagging.

 

Can I use a single external drive where I plug it into my computer to do the organizing then give it to my wife to do the editing? I've tried keeping both computers synced by using backup but with thousands of photos it takes hours.

 

Any help would be appreciated, Thank in advance. Jerry

Have a look at that recent discussion:

https://community.adobe.com/t5/photoshop-elements-discussions/user-folders-goes-on-and-on/m-p/134115...

You'll find the solution to share a catalog and the associated media file library between two computers by storing them on an external drive.

Note, remember the licenses are single user ones, You are expected to have separate licenses even if you are allowed to have each of you two activated computers.
